/ 47.608°N 122.152°W / 47.608; -122.152 Sammamish High School (commonly Sammamish or SHS) is a public secondary school in Bellevue, Washington, US, serving students in grades 9 – 12.

Sammamish High School. The school's nickname is the Totems, the mascot is the Thunderbird, and its colors are red, black, and white. The current principal is Scott Powers, with Thomas Gangle and Anecia Grigsby as assistant principals.
